Зарезервированные поля САПР для форматов MicroStation V8 DGN
В следующей таблице приведены имена полей, которые зарезервированы для чтения и записи данных V8 DGN CAD в ArcGIS for Desktop. Можно использовать их для перезаписи выходных данных по умолчанию в инструменте Экспорт в САПР (Export To CAD) путем добавления их в таблицу классов входных объектов. Поля, отмеченные, как доступные только для чтения, предназначены исключительно для прямого чтения таблиц атрибутов (виртуальных) САПР и не могут быть использованы.
Категория |
Имя поля |
Тип данных |
Длина |
Описание |
---|---|---|---|---|
Свойства элемента | FID | ObjectID | 4 | Уникальный идентификатор объекта
|
Форма | Геометрия | - | Площадная фигура ArcGIS, представляющая пространственный экстент файла САПР
| |
Примитив | Строка | 16 | Примитив САПР
| |
Заголовок | Строка | 16 | Уникальный идентификатор примитива САПР
| |
Угол |
Число двойной точности |
8 |
Угол поворота в градусах
| |
<attribute name> |
Текст, длинное целое число или число двойной точности |
8 |
Поименованный, определенный пользователем текстовый примитив, используемый для хранения данных | |
CadType | Строка | 255 | Допустимое значение переопределяет выходной тип элемента по умолчанию. Некоторые типы элементов нуждаются в сопроводительных полях, в которых задаются параметры. Например:
| |
CadModel |
Строка |
255 |
Компонент файла DGN, содержащий элементы | |
Класс |
Строка |
255 |
Обозначение класса примитива | |
Цвет |
Краткое целое число |
2 |
Цвет отображения примитива, выраженный целым числом | |
Рельеф |
Число двойной точности |
8 |
Значение Z-координаты примитива
| |
EntColor |
Краткое целое число |
2 |
Назначенный примитиву цвет, выраженный целым числом | |
EntLinetype |
Строка |
255 |
Тип линии, назначенный примитиву | |
EntLineWt |
Краткое целое число |
2 |
Толщина линии, назначенная примитиву | |
Заливка |
Краткое целое число |
2 |
Название образца заливки | |
GGroup |
Краткое целое число |
2 |
Графическая группа, к которой принадлежит примитив | |
LineWt |
Краткое целое число |
2 |
Отображаемая толщина линии примитива | |
Тип линии |
Строка |
255 |
Отображаемый тип линии примитива | |
LTScale |
Число двойной точности |
8 |
Масштаб типа линии примитива | |
MSLink-DMRS |
Длинное целое число |
4 |
Уникальный идентификатор, используемый в качественного первичного ключа для связи графического элемента с записью в таблице внешней базы данных
| |
MSCtlg-DMRS |
Длинное целое число |
4 |
Идентификатор в реляционной таблице MSCatalog, однозначно определяющий таблицу, содержащую MSLink
| |
QrotX |
Число двойной точности |
8 |
Значение Х-координаты поворота (3D) кватерниона | |
QrotY |
Число двойной точности |
8 |
Значение Y-координаты поворота (3D) кватерниона | |
QrotZ |
Число двойной точности |
8 |
Значение Z-координаты поворота (3D) кватерниона | |
RefName |
Строка |
255 |
Имя родительского объекта, в котором находится примитив | |
ScaleX |
Число двойной точности |
8 |
Значение масштаба по оси Х
| |
ScaleY |
Число двойной точности |
8 |
Значение масштаба по оси Y
| |
ScaleZ |
Число двойной точности |
8 |
Значение масштаба по оси Z
| |
Свойства слоя | Слой | Строка | 255 | Имя слоя чертежа САПР |
Уровень |
Длинное целое число |
4 |
Уникальный идентификатор слоя чертежа САПР | |
LvlDesc |
Строка |
255 |
Описание уровня САПР
| |
LvlPlot |
Краткое целое число |
2 |
Порядок вычерчивания уровней чертежа САПР | |
LyrColor |
Краткое целое число |
2 |
Цвет слоя чертежа САПР, выраженный целым числом | |
LyrFrzn |
Краткое целое число |
2 |
Состояние заморожен/разморожен слоя чертежа САПР | |
LyrLinetype |
Строка |
255 |
Тип линии слоя чертежа САПР, в котором находится примитив | |
LyrLineWt |
Краткое целое число |
2 |
Толщина линии слоя чертежа САПР, в котором находится примитив | |
LyrLock |
Краткое целое число |
2 |
Состояние блокирован/разблокирован слоя чертежа САПР | |
LyrOn |
Краткое целое число |
2 |
Состояние вкл./выкл. слоя чертежа САПР | |
Свойства текста |
FontId |
Краткое целое число |
2 |
ID текстового символа ArcGIS
|
Высота |
Число двойной точности |
8 |
Высота текста в единицах САПР | |
LnSpace |
Краткое целое число |
2 |
Тип интервала многострочного текста
| |
SpaceFact |
Число двойной точности |
8 |
Коэффициент заполнения многострочного текста
| |
TxtStyle |
Строка |
255 |
Стиль текста | |
Текст |
Строка |
255 |
Текстовая строка | |
TxtAttach |
Краткое целое число |
2 |
Параметр присоединения многострочного текста | |
TxtBoxHt |
Число двойной точности |
8 |
Высота прямоугольника, ограничивающего текстовый примитив | |
TxtBoxWd |
Число двойной точности |
8 |
Ширина прямоугольника, ограничивающего текстовый примитив | |
TxtDir |
Краткое целое число |
2 |
Параметр направления многострочного текста | |
TxtFont |
Строка |
255 |
Шрифт САПР текстового примитива | |
TxtJust |
Строка |
32 |
Параметр выравнивания текстового объекта
| |
TxtHt | Число двойной точности | 8 | Высота текстового примитива | |
TxtMemo |
Строка |
2048 |
Неусеченная, целая текстовая строка | |
TxtOblique |
Число двойной точности |
8 |
Угол наклона текстового примитива
| |
TxtRefWd |
Число двойной точности |
8 |
Коэффициент ширины многострочного текста
| |
TxtRotate | Число двойной точности | 8 | Угол вращения текстового примитива | |
TxtValue | Строка | 255 | Текстовая строка для нового текста, созданного на основе точечных объектов, если поле CADType содержит ключевое слово TEXT. | |
TxtWidth |
Число двойной точности |
8 |
Коэффициент ширины текстового примитива
| |
VertAlign |
Строка |
32 |
Параметр вертикального выравнивания текстового примитива
| |
Свойства документа |
DocName |
Строка |
255 |
Имя файла САПР, включая его расширение |
DocPath |
Строка |
4096 |
Полный путь к файлу САПР, включая имя файла
| |
DocType |
Строка |
255 |
Расширение файла, ассоциированное с форматом САПР | |
DocVer |
Строка |
16 |
Версия формата САПР |